During the meeting of the Committee on Economic Reforms, Ukrainian President Viktor Yanukovych appointed vice Prime Minister - infrastructure minister Borys Kolesnikov as responsible for the Affordable Housing program implementation, ForUm correspondent reports.

"The Affordable Housing program is a long-term social project, which is to solve not only the housing problems. I instruct vice Prime Minister Kolesnikov to implement this program together with the minister (regional development, construction and housing and communal services minister of Ukraine Anatoly - Ed.) Blyzniuk," he said.

Yanukovych explained this decision by saying that Kolesnikov is not so busy after the European Football Championship 2012 is over.

President paid special attention to Kyiv. Head of the KCSA Oleksandr Popov was instructed to eliminate protracted constructions in the capital.
